The bottom line

SW16 4SA offers exceptional schools (100% Good/Outstanding) and low crime — strong value for Families and Owner-occupiers who can accept its trade-offs.

The catch: 48 min to victoria — above average for this zone.

Less suited to Car-free commuters.
